Fundamental Competencies for Results-Driven Medical Therapy

Effective medical massage uses a assortment of techniques intended to diminish pain and facilitate healing. Among these approaches, deep tissue massage concentrates on adjusting deeper layers of muscles and connective tissue, often addressing chronic aches and pain. Trigger point therapy pinpoints and discharges specific knots within muscles, providing immediate relief to localized discomfort. Swedish massage, marked by long, flowing strokes, boosts relaxation while improving circulation and flexibility. Additionally, myofascial release manages restrictions in the fascia, allowing greater mobility and reducing tension. Sports massage, designed for athletes, combines techniques to avert injuries and ease muscle soreness post-exercise. Each of these methods can be adjusted based on individual needs, confirming a thorough approach to pain management. By merging these techniques, medical massage practitioners aim to create a balanced therapeutic experience that addresses both physical discomfort and emotional stress, ultimately promoting an environment conducive to healing.

Learn What Happens During Your First Medical Bodywork Session?

During the initial therapeutic massage session, clients can generally expect a structured and informative process. Upon check-in, they will likely fill out a health intake form, detailing health background and particular problem areas. This data helps the practitioner tailor the session to personal requirements.

After this, a discussion will ensue, enabling the therapist to clarify any questions and establish treatment goals. Clients are urged to communicate openly about their ease of mind throughout the session.

The massage session may utilize various strategies, concentrated on alleviating pain and advancing relaxation. Clients should realize that pressure levels can be fine-tuned to align with their wants.

Following the session, therapists often deliver recommendations for subsequent treatment or self-management strategies, emphasizing the importance of consistent interaction. All in all, the opening session is designed to build trust and create the foundation for effective treatment moving forward.

Do Medical Massage Treatments Have Any Potential Side Effects?

Remedial work may trigger brief effects including soreness, contusions, or weariness. On occasion, individuals might encounter emotional outbursts or increased sensitivity. Speaking to a specialist can offer support in addressing any questions before and after the procedure.
